HSE Construction Guidance: Who Qualifies and What You Get
Learn how construction tradespeople can access free legal guidance to help prevent accidents on the job site.
This scheme provides free legal guidance designed to help people working in the building trades avoid accidents on site.
Who it's for
This guidance is intended for all construction tradespeople. Whether you are working as a self-employed individual or part of a larger team, these resources are designed to be accessible to everyone working within the construction sector.
What you get
You receive free legal guidance aimed at helping you identify risks and avoid accidents while working on site. These resources provide the necessary information to help you understand your safety responsibilities and the legal standards required to keep your work environment secure. By following this guidance, you can better protect yourself and others from the physical risks inherent in building work.
What it costs you
There is no monetary cost to access this information. However, there is a commitment of time required. To make the guidance effective, you must dedicate time to reading the provided materials and, more importantly, you must take the time to actually implement the safety protocols within your daily work routines.
The catch to know
A common mistake is failing to pay close enough attention to specific high-risk areas. The most significant thing people often miss is ignoring the specific asbestos regulations that apply when you are working in older properties. Ensuring you are fully aware of these particular rules is essential for site safety.
